media-19046.jpeg UPL 19046 Luftwaffe Airfield Dessau May 30,1944. Sortie 1670 of the 7th photo group based at Mount Farm, UK. The pilot Lt John S Blyth was with the 14th Squadron and was flying Spitfire MK XI PA841. Altitude was approximately 30,000ft. This was a Junker's factory airfield.

Supermarine Spitfire PA841 Mk PRXIT Const #4993, Built at Chattis Hill.

FF 30-10-43, Delivered to Benson 6-11-43, assigned to 14PS, 7PG, 8AF USAAF 5-12-43, HAL 5-4-45, recat E, SOC 13-9-45.
